break,continue,return的区别为:作用不同、结束不同、紧跟不同。 一、作用不同 1、break:执行break操作,跳出所在的当前整个循环,到外层代码继续执行。 2、continue:执行continue操作,跳出本次循环,从下一个迭代继续运行循环,内层循环执行完毕,外层代码继续运行。 3、return:执行return操作,直接返回函数,所有该函数体内...
log(nonull); return false; // 跳出当前$(".showdetailsadd input").each()的循环, 并不是函数的return } }) //继续往下执行 if (nonull) { console.log(nonull); $scope.XHRmessage_show = nonull + "输入有误或未输入"; $scope.message_show_f = true; $timeout(function () { $scope.mes...
js 函数中 return 之后,会退出当前的函数,所以在同一个函数中return下面的代码是执行不了的我觉得在你的代码中,confirm 和 replace 的事件绑定没有必要放在 btn.onclick 中。btn.onclick 中只需要显示 popup,然后把验证和确认的代码放在 confirm 的绑定函数中,把取消的代码放在 replace 的绑定函数中即可。 有用 ...
3 js定义函数 4 定义函数内容 5 执行函数 6 预览效果如图 7 在函数内容前加入return 8 预览效果如图函数内容永远不会被执行附上代码使用 return 语句时function han(){return;document.getElementById("re").innerHTML="欢迎你来到这";}han();
return只能出现在函数里,如果出现在上面实例里的for循环里就会报错,return出现在函数里的作用就是即使下面还有内容也不再继续往下执行了,最常见的就是在函数里判断参数是否符合要求, 如果不符合要求就不再继续往下执行: functioncheckHandle(str){ if(str.length>5){ ...
终止JS运行有如下几种可能:一. 终止函数的运行的方式有两种:1、在函数中使用return,则当遇到return时,函数终止执行,控制权继续向下运行。2、在函数中使用try-catch异常处理,需要结束时,使用throw抛出异常。二. 终止动画特效的运行的方式是使用stop方法:1、 stop([clearQueue], [gotoEnd]) :停止...
let username = ''functionabc(){if(username==""){ alert("请输入用户名");returnfalse;//因为username不符合我们的要求,所以在这里用return来终于函数往下继续执行} alert("欢迎你"+username); } abc() 上面实例里,如果username符合我们的要求,那么就会弹出“欢迎你”的提示框,如果不合要求,就会弹出“请输入...
有没有返回值,没有返回值的话,你的 if(alertify.confirm) 是 false,return flagFun() 不会执行...
,return 语句会 终止函数的执行并返回函数的值。故应选用其他逻辑实现中断哦 (~ ̄▽ ̄)~
问题:在js中使用if进行判断的时候,if中的条件方法还没执行判断结束,就直接跳到执行else的代码了...问题业务场景:需要通过调用调用接口判断当前的状态,并且在不同状态下响应不同的业务逻辑。...首先,一开始我的想法是,使用一个函数,将调用接口判断状态的代码放